About This Program

LIHEAP, Low Income Home Energy Assistance Program is available to homeowners and renters in San Jose, CA.

LIHEAP provides federally funded energy bill assistance and crisis grants to income-qualified California households, helping pay heating, cooling, and emergency energy bills. In Santa Clara County, benefits range from $94-$1,500 for heating and up to $932 for cooling. While not a home improvement grant, LIHEAP directly reduces the financial burden of operating home systems, freeing funds for repairs.

Key Details

  • Up to $1,500 for heating; $932 for cooling assistance
  • Income limit: 60% of California State Median Income
  • Heating, cooling, and crisis bill assistance
  • Apply at CALIHEAPApply.com or call 1-866-675-6623
  • Both homeowners and renters qualify
